British Foreign Secretary reaffirms support for JCPOA

In the second telephone conversation of Iranian FM Zarif and UK Foreign Secretary Johnson in the past days, the British diplomat reaffirmed Britain’s support for the nuclear accord.
British Foreign Secretary reaffirms support for JCPOA
 
British Foreign Secretary, Boris Johnson, reaffirmed UK’s support for the JCPOA (the Joint Comprehensive Plan of Action also known as Iran nuclear deal signed between Iran and 5+1 group countries on July 14, 2015 in Vienna) during the telephone conversation with Iranian Foreign Minister Mohammad Javad Zarif on Sunday, reported the public and media diplomacy office of Iranian ministry.

During the conversation over the phone line which was the second dialogue of the two diplomat over the last couple of years, the British diplomat also called all signatories of the agreement to be committed to the terms of the accord.

The last telephone contact of the two diplomats was on past Tuesday.
